Market context

London Spirit Women face Birmingham Phoenix Women at Lord’s in The Hundred on 9 August, with the market already pricing an almost certain result in favour of a completed, officially decided match. BBC Sport’s live coverage lists the fixture as due to start at 14:30, and Cricbuzz shows Phoenix won the toss and chose to bowl, which is the main immediate match-day variable rather than anything structural in the market itself.[1][3]

The current 99% implied probability is much higher than the pre-match cricket previews, which generally treated this as a competitive but low-quality clash rather than a foregone conclusion. Several previews note both sides have been underwhelming this season, with each sitting on six points from six games and London Spirit on a three-match losing run, yet the head-to-head record has leaned strongly towards Spirit, who have won the last five meetings cited by multiple preview outlets.[4][9][14] That combination explains why traders may be leaning on historical match-up strength more than current league position.

The main catalyst to watch is whether the match is completed and formally produces a winner under the playing conditions, because the market resolves any ordinary win, including via DLS, DRS outcomes, penalties, forfeits, or a tiebreak if one is used.[1] The live match state, weather interruptions, and any official abandonment notices matter more than pre-match narrative; BBC’s live service and Cricbuzz’s score feed are the clearest sources for those real-time dependencies.[1][3]

Resolution & payout

Political markets typically settle on official candidate or agency confirmation. Polymarket uses UMA Optimistic Oracle: a proposer posts the outcome with a bond, the two-hour window opens, then the smart contract pays USDC.

Kalshi settles USD via CFTC clearinghouse, with clearly defined resolution sources (e.g. AP race calls for elections). Betfair settles after the official outcome is registered with the league or agency. Manifold is play-money.
